`
- 浏览:
214810 次
- 性别:
- 来自:
成都
-
在linux下装了个Azureus,使用基本没多少问题。但是NAT端口测试的时候15559端口老是测试不成功,当然了,可能是端口没打开吧。其实我们也可以换成其它的端口。对于Ubuntu下Azureus出问题,一般有两种可能性比较大.一是程序运行不起来,这和JDK版本不兼容有关系,一般更新到JDK6就可以解决问题.另一是关于NAT配置问题
首先运行下列命令赋予Azureus一个端口:
iptables -I INPUT -p tcp --dport < your_port_number > -j ACCEPT
iptables -I INPUT -p udp --dport < your_port_number > -j ACCEPT
其中your_port_number是端口号,可以赋予49125-65535 之间的任意值.然后创建一个文件
/etc/init.d/iptables_azureus
再写入下列信息:
(sleep 220
/sbin/iptables -I INPUT -p tcp --dport -j ACCEPT
/sbin/iptables -I INPUT -p udp --dport -j ACCEPT ) &
上面取值220,这是值足够大,(用来等待防火墙验证以及配置信息等等),你可以设置小点.
然后使该文件可执行并写入启动项.
chmod +x /etc/init.d/iptables_azureus
update-rc.d iptables_azureus start 51 S .
这里一定要注意51 S后面还有一个点。
以上设置以后基本没多少问题,但是如果你的网络是通过路由器上网的话就不同了。
分享到:
Global site tag (gtag.js) - Google Analytics
相关推荐
- Ubuntu下有多种BT客户端可供选择,如**Bittorrent**和**uTorrent**的替代品**Azureus**(现更名为Vuze),以及**BitTyrant**等,它们均支持高速下载和种子搜索,满足用户对P2P资源的需求。 ### 系统管理类 - 在...
`.project`文件是Eclipse项目配置的元数据,它包含了项目类型、构建设置、构建路径、Nature(项目特性)等信息,这些信息帮助Eclipse识别和管理项目。 `src`目录则包含了Azureus的源代码,这是理解项目工作原理的...
azureus 是一个linux下很不错的bit下载客户端软件,这是最新版,下载解压即可用!
此外,通过分析源代码,开发者可以了解如何实现高效的文件分发策略,如DHT(分布式哈希表)用于节点发现,以及UPnP和NAT-PMP技术,这些技术帮助穿透防火墙和路由器,使得对等方之间的连接更加顺畅。 在开发过程中,...
5. **Vuze/Azureus特性**:探索Vuze的高级功能,如DHT(分布式哈希表)技术、UPnP/NAT-PMP端口映射、磁力链接支持等,以及其多媒体处理能力。 6. **日志管理与版本控制**:了解软件开发中的日志记录重要性,以及...
一个基于JAVA的多torrent下载程序,可以手动设置某个torrent的优先权,加入了irc聊天室,增加了一些基本的irc命令,可以看见在线人数和ID,支持多tracker url,对于多tracker发布的torrent可自动切换,并可以手动...
一个基于JAVA的多torrent下载程序,可以手动设置某个torrent的优先权,加入了irc聊天室,增加了一些基本的irc命令,可以看见在线人数和ID,支持多tracker url,对于多tracker发布的torrent可自动切换,并可以手动...
标题"Azureus 2.5.0.4 Source"指的是Azureus软件的源代码版本,具体为2.5.0.4更新。Azureus是一款基于Java实现的BitTorrent客户端,它支持P2P(对等网络)技术进行文件的上传与下载。这款开源软件为用户提供了高效且...
- **高级特性**:包括DHT(分布式哈希表)、UPnP端口映射、NAT-PMP等,以优化网络连接。 - **元数据交换**:通过交换.torrent文件,用户可以获取到文件的详细信息,如大小、种子数量等。 - **用户界面**:Azureus...
一个基于JAVA的多torrent下载程序,可以手动设置某个torrent的优先权,加入了irc聊天室,增加了一些基本的irc命令,可以看见在线人数和ID,支持多tracker url,对于多tracker发布的torrent可自动切换,并可以手动...
- **DHT Network**:在没有Tracker的情况下,Azureus使用DHT网络找到其他peers,实现去中心化的发现机制。 - **Piece Manager**:负责文件的分片和校验,确保数据的完整性和一致性。 - **Bandwidth Manager**:...
基于java的开发源码-P2P源码 Azureus 2.5.0.2(JAVA).zip 基于java的开发源码-P2P源码 Azureus 2.5.0.2(JAVA).zip 基于java的开发源码-P2P源码 Azureus 2.5.0.2(JAVA).zip 基于java的开发源码-P2P源码 Azureus 2.5....
3. **网络编程**:Azureus涉及到大量的网络通信,包括TCP/IP套接字编程,如Socket和ServerSocket类的使用,以及HTTP和UPnP协议的理解,用于端口转发以穿透NAT。 4. **事件驱动编程**:Azureus使用了事件驱动模型,...
一个程基于Java的多torrent下载序,可以手动设置某个torrent的优先权,加入了irc聊天室,增加了一些基本的irc命令,可以看见在线人数和ID,支持多tracker url,对于多tracker发布的torrent可自动切换,并可以手动...
曾经推荐使用azureus,但现在有更好的替代品,如奔流(benliud)。 8. **编译工具**: 安装build-essential包,包含编译软件所需的工具链。 9. **RAR解压**: 通过"新立得软件管理"安装unrar,以支持RAR文件的...
以下是一些针对Ubuntu 8.10版本的常用软件安装、设置和配置的步骤,这些步骤同样适用于后续的Ubuntu版本,尽管随着时间的推移,部分配置已变得更加自动化。 1. **更新系统和软件源**: - 打开“系统”>“系统管理...
azureus破解版 azureus破解版 azureus破解版
Azureus是一款著名的P2P(peer-to-peer)文件分享客户端软件,主要基于BitTorrent协议进行运作。这款软件的源码是用Java编程语言编写的,因此对于Java开发者来说,研究Azureus的源码是一个深入了解P2P网络和...
6. **数据结构与算法**:为了高效地管理文件块的下载和上传,Azureus可能使用了特定的数据结构,如优先队列、哈希表等,以及一些优化的算法,比如选择下一个下载的块或分配上传带宽。 7. **用户界面**:虽然Azureus...
Azureus是一款著名的P2P(peer-to-peer)文件共享软件,最初由澳大利亚的软件开发者Mitchell Krawczyk开发,并且完全基于Java编程语言。在本文中,我们将深入探讨Azureus 2.5.0.2版本的源码,以及与Java相关的技术点...